What are the fees and charges associated with trading cryptocurrencies on eToro Singapore?
Can you provide a detailed explanation of the fees and charges that are involved when trading cryptocurrencies on eToro Singapore? I would like to understand the costs associated with trading on this platform before I start investing.
3 answers
- Anjali OzaOct 25, 2024 · 2 years agoSure! When trading cryptocurrencies on eToro Singapore, there are several fees and charges that you should be aware of. Firstly, eToro charges a spread fee, which is the difference between the buy and sell price of a cryptocurrency. This fee is applied to every trade and is how eToro makes money. Additionally, eToro charges an overnight fee for positions that are held open overnight. The overnight fee is calculated based on the size of the position and the current market conditions. It's important to note that eToro also charges a withdrawal fee for transferring funds out of the platform. The withdrawal fee varies depending on the cryptocurrency and the amount being withdrawn. Lastly, eToro may also charge a conversion fee if you're trading cryptocurrencies that are not denominated in your account's base currency. It's always a good idea to review the fee schedule on eToro's website for the most up-to-date information on fees and charges.
